Grabowstraße 32, 17291 Prenzlau, Deutschland - In the world of medicine, the change is often part of life, and Christian Scheer also knows that. After more than 32 years at the Prenzlau district hospital, the 58-year-old specialist in internal medicine, specializing in cardiology and diabetology, will face a new challenge from July 1, 2025. As Nordkurier , a separate practice will be in the future in Grabowstrasse 32 in Prenzlau in the future take over.
his professional career is impressive: after studying medicine at the Martin Luther University Halle-Wittenberg, Scheer started in 1992 as an assistant doctor in Prenzlau, spent his training as a specialist in cardiology at the Schwedter Clinic in Uckermark and returned as a senior senior doctor in 2007. Since 2012 he has been the fate of the inner clinic as chief physician. The farewell is not easy, because the deep personal connections to his colleagues make the change bitter.
renovation plans and new ways
The impetus for his change are the recently presented renovation plans for the medically social center (MSZ) Uckermark, which provide for a conversion of the Prenzlau location into a specialist clinic for geriatric medicine. In particular, the closure of important areas, such as the intensive care unit, limits the Scheer's field of action considerably. He sees the takeover of his own practice as the opportunity to live his passion for cardiology in a new environment.
In his new practice, the experienced cardiologist plans to offer a comprehensive range of services, including cardiological diagnostics, cardiac ultrasound, ergometry and long-term ECG. On July 9, 2025, the first outpatient consultation hour will take place in which he would like to look after patients who suffer from cardiovascular diseases-one of the most common causes of death in Germany. These diseases, which include heart attacks and high blood pressure, make it necessary that high -quality medical care is also available in rural areas.
cardiology - a comprehensive field
Cardiology is not only the largest area of internal medicine, but also includes many different aspects, such as Ärzteblatt . In addition to specialization in cardiology, the 72-month-comprehensive specialist training also requires experience in other areas such as emergency and intensive care medicine. Despite the challenges that cardiologists face, the demand for their expertise remains high. Around 5,712 specialists in internal medicine and cardiology work in Germany, many of which are urgently needed.
